bl双性强迫侵犯h_国产在线观看人成激情视频_蜜芽188_被诱拐的少孩全彩啪啪漫画

Drupal8系列(四):主題制作的前期準(zhǔn)備-Ubuntu14.04LTS

當(dāng)我下載了Drupal-8.0.0-alpha版之后,十分有興致地去下載排行在前面的8.x開發(fā)版的主題,想大致做個(gè)試驗(yàn)性質(zhì)的網(wǎng)站,但結(jié)果卻大大出乎我的意料,大部分的主題都不能正常應(yīng)用,在百般糾結(jié)之下,還是一咬牙下決心作一個(gè)主題好了!

創(chuàng)新互聯(lián)是一家專業(yè)提供定州企業(yè)網(wǎng)站建設(shè),專注與成都網(wǎng)站制作、成都網(wǎng)站設(shè)計(jì)、H5技術(shù)、小程序制作等業(yè)務(wù)。10年已為定州眾多企業(yè)、政府機(jī)構(gòu)等服務(wù)。創(chuàng)新互聯(lián)專業(yè)網(wǎng)站制作公司優(yōu)惠進(jìn)行中。

如果大家留意我以前的博客就不難發(fā)現(xiàn),我比較偏好BootStrap框架,所以這次就基于BootStrap框架來制作一個(gè)主題!既然是對新事物的嘗試,我想不妨把我感興趣的Sass、Compass也一起集成在主題里。所以在我的主題中需要做一些初始化的設(shè)置,由于Ubuntu軟件庫中已經(jīng)編譯好的軟件版本都比較舊,所以打算使用gem進(jìn)行安裝:

一、安裝Ruby

首先是Ruby以及ruby-dev,一般而言Ubuntu安裝之后都會(huì)自動(dòng)安裝Ruby的。如果沒有的話,也沒有關(guān)系,直接:

sudo apt-get install ruby ruby-dev

就可以安裝好Ruby了,注意在Ubuntu 14.04 LTS中的Ruby包已經(jīng)包含了gem,所以不需要再象以前那樣安裝gem包了。

二、設(shè)置gem

接下來就是設(shè)置gem的源了,由于眾所周知的原因,在國內(nèi)使用 gem安裝經(jīng)常會(huì)出現(xiàn)找不到資源的錯(cuò)誤,所以我們需要對gem源做一些設(shè)置:

gem source -r http://rubygems.org/
gem source -a http://ruby.taobao.org/

這樣,我們的gem源中就有了淘寶的gem源了,如下所示:

gem sources list
*** CURRENT SOURCES ***
http://ruby.taobao.org/

三、安裝Sass

在設(shè)置了源之后,就可以開始安裝Sass了,Sass安裝十分簡單:

sudo gem install sass
Fetching: sass-3.3.14.gem (100%)
Successfully installed sass-3.3.14
1 gem installed
Installing ri documentation for sass-3.3.14...
Installing RDoc documentation for sass-3.3.14...

出現(xiàn)以上提示,說明sass已經(jīng)安裝好了。

四、安裝Compass

接下來是安裝Sass的Compass框架了,由于Sass 3.3.x與Compass穩(wěn)定版兼容性不是很好,所以我們安裝它的1.0.0rc1版,安裝也很方便:

sudo gem install compass --pre
Building native extensions.  This could take a while...
Fetching: rb-inotify-0.9.5.gem (100%)
Fetching: compass-1.0.0.rc.1.gem (100%)
    Compass is charityware. If you love it, please donate on our behalf at http://umdf.org/compass Thanks!
Successfully installed ffi-1.9.3
Successfully installed rb-inotify-0.9.5
Successfully installed compass-1.0.0.rc.1
3 gems installed
Installing ri documentation for ffi-1.9.3...
... ...
Installing RDoc documentation for rb-inotify-0.9.5...
Installing RDoc documentation for compass-1.0.0.rc.1...

這樣就安裝好了Compass了

更正:

目前compass1.0.1已經(jīng)是正式版了,所以只需要使用正常安裝,無須使用--pre參數(shù)

sudo gem install compass

五、安裝Bootstrap-sass

BootStrap不用多說,大家都知道它是用Less作為源碼的。但是Sass強(qiáng)大的編程能力和Compass豐富的底層函數(shù)又是我們所需要的,不過好在推特的技術(shù)非常雄厚,他們又用Sass把BootStrap重新改寫了,這便是Bootstrap-sass了。安裝Bootstrap-sass也很簡單,直接輸入下面的語句:

sudo gem install bootstrap-sass
[sudo] password for firehare: 
Fetching: bootstrap-sass-3.2.0.1.gem (100%)
Successfully installed bootstrap-sass-3.2.0.1
1 gem installed
Installing ri documentation for bootstrap-sass-3.2.0.1...
Installing RDoc documentation for bootstrap-sass-3.2.0.1...

這樣,我們就基本上把制作主題所需要的軟件都已經(jīng)準(zhǔn)備好了。接下來就正式進(jìn)入主題制作了!

新聞名稱:Drupal8系列(四):主題制作的前期準(zhǔn)備-Ubuntu14.04LTS
地址分享:http://vcdvsql.cn/article8/jhpcip.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供域名注冊、Google網(wǎng)站收錄、網(wǎng)站建設(shè)、用戶體驗(yàn)、小程序開發(fā)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)

h5響應(yīng)式網(wǎng)站建設(shè)